Faux blooms and botanicals are no longer just a practical alternative to fresh flowers. With “Artificial Plant” searches up +520% year-on-year on Press Loft, journalists are clearly looking at lasting greenery as a styling detail in its own right, from sculptural orchids and bonsai-style pieces to abundant arrangements, potted foliage and delicate floral stems.
Bringing colour, softness and a natural feel to interiors without the upkeep, this trend speaks to the growing appetite for pieces that can be styled season after season. Whether used to lift a bathroom corner, add height to shelving, dress a tablescape or create a statement floral moment, faux botanicals offer an easy way to make spaces feel layered, lived-in and considered.
